Maximizing Efficiency And Profit With Stock Control Software

In today’s fast-paced business environment, it is crucial for companies to have an effective stock control system in place. This is where stock control software comes into play. stock control software is a powerful tool that helps businesses manage their inventory more efficiently, ultimately leading to increased profitability.

stock control software allows businesses to keep track of their inventory levels in real-time. This means that businesses can accurately monitor how much stock they have on hand, how much is in transit, and when they need to reorder. By having this information readily available, businesses can avoid overstocking or stockouts, both of which can have a negative impact on their bottom line.

Another key benefit of stock control software is its ability to automate various inventory management tasks. For example, businesses can set up automatic alerts to notify them when stock levels are running low or when it is time to reorder. This helps businesses stay on top of their inventory without having to constantly monitor it manually.

stock control software also enables businesses to track and analyze their inventory data more effectively. Businesses can generate reports on their inventory turnover, stock levels, and sales trends, among other things. By analyzing this data, businesses can identify inefficiencies in their inventory management processes and make informed decisions to improve them.

Furthermore, stock control software can help businesses reduce the risk of human error in inventory management. Manual inventory management processes are prone to errors, such as misplaced items or incorrect stock counts. Stock control software automates many of these tasks, reducing the chances of human error and ensuring greater accuracy in inventory management.

Stock control software is also beneficial for businesses that have multiple locations or warehouses. By centralizing their inventory data in one system, businesses can easily track stock levels across all locations and make informed decisions about allocation and distribution. This helps businesses optimize their inventory levels and reduce carrying costs.

Additionally, stock control software can integrate with other business systems, such as accounting and sales software. This allows businesses to streamline their operations and improve overall efficiency. For example, stock control software can automatically update inventory levels in the accounting system when new stock is received or sales are made, eliminating the need for manual data entry and reducing the risk of errors.
